: In TWRP, go to the "Wipe" section. Select "Advanced Wipe" and choose the Dalvik/ART Cache, System, Data, and Cache partitions. Swipe to wipe them. Do not wipe your Internal Storage unless you have a backup on your PC. This step ensures a clean installation without conflicts from the old ROM. nokia 24 custom rom
